This time I have for You some bigger amount of synthetic music from various 8-bit and 16-bit computers. While making this album I used:
- ZX81 with ZXpand and TurboSound (two YM2149 chips)
- ZX Spectrum 48K with AY-interface
- Speccy2010 and TurboSound (two AY chips implemented)
- Sam Coupe (Philips SAA chip)
- Atari 520ST (YM2149 chip)
- Amiga 500 (Paula chip).
I make chiptunes on ZX Spectrum computer since 1989. Its AY chip offers 4-bit sound, 3 channels + white noise generator, square wave and several 'buzzers'. Or 3 channels of 4-bit digital sound, but then I have to fit all samples in 48Kb of RAM. :) My other machines: Amiga 500, Amiga 1200, Atari Falcon 030, NES/Famicom, Raspberry Pi and others.
